- The first step in fixing resin anchors is selecting the appropriate type of resin. There are two main categories epoxy resins and polyurethane resins. Epoxy resins offer excellent adhesion and strength but require a longer curing time, while polyurethane resins cure faster but may have slightly lower strength properties.

- M24 chemical anchors are essentially high-strength fastening systems that utilize a chemical adhesive to bond with the substrate. They are composed of a metal sleeve or anchor body, often made from steel or stainless steel, and a specially formulated two-part epoxy or resin. The chemical component is what sets these anchors apart, as it not only provides exceptional holding power but also adapts to various environmental conditions.
A CSK head self-drilling screw features a unique head design that tapers down to meet the surface of the material being fastened. This countersunk design allows the screw to sit flush with or below the surface, providing a clean finish. The self-drilling capability stems from a drill-like point, which allows the screw to create its hole as it is driven into the material. These screws are typically made from high-strength steel or stainless steel, making them suitable for various applications.
- Mudsill anchor bolts come in various sizes and designs, but their function remains constant to resist uplift forces and prevent the separation of the building from its foundation. They are typically installed during the foundation pouring process, with the bolts embedded into the concrete, allowing the mudsill to be securely fastened once it is placed.
